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Lobito's airport?
Lobito has just one airport, Catumbela Airport (CBT).
How far is Catumbela Airport (CBT) from central Lobito?
Catumbela Airport is 18 kilometres from downtown Lobito, so expect a reasonable commute into the city centre.
What airport is best to fly into Lobito?
People from all around the world pass through Catumbela Airport each day. Step off the plane, gather your bags and you'll be 18 kilometres from the centre of Lobito.
How many airlines fly to Lobito?
With 2 air carriers flying into Lobito from 2 airports around the world, your perfect flight is just a few clicks away.
Which airlines fly to Lobito?
Lobito receives the highest number of flights from FLY AO, FLY AO and TAAG Angola Airlines with FLY AO being the preferred choice of airline. Luanda is the most popular city for travellers to jet off from.
How many nonstop flights are there to Lobito?
Arranging an unforgettable Lobito getaway is a walk in the park when there are 7 nonstop flights each week to choose from.
Where are the most popular flights to Lobito departing from?
Luanda and Windhoek airports are common departure points for travellers flying to Lobito.
How long is the flight to Lobito Airport?
From the moment you take off from Luanda, you'll be in the air for about 1 hour before you touchdown in Lobito. Jet-setters coming in from Windhoek can expect to be onboard for around 2 hours and 10 minutes.

Do you have any tips for my flight to Lobito?
No matter where you're coming from, flying can be a seamless experience if you're well organised. We've put together a list of handy hints that will help get your Lobito escape started on the right note.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• First of all, put in your passport, important documents, wallet and vital medications. Next, you'll need some extra in-flight entertainment to help pass the time. A juicy novel and a phone filled with your favourite shows are good options. If you hope to take a quick snooze, a quality neck pillow and a pair of earplugs will also come in handy. Finally, squeeze in a toothbrush and some deodorant so you'll touchdown looking and feeling fresh.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Leave all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and hairspray in your checked baggage. Any li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) won't be allowed on. Sharp objects, like your precious Swiss Army knife, and products which are flammable or explosive, such as spray paint, flares and strong acids, are also restricted.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of an aircraft aren't the place for a fashion parade. Don comfortable layers and go for shoes that are roomy, flat and easy to remove.
  • You're probably aware of de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ity. To lower your risk on board, drink lots of water, consider wearing compression socks or tights and move your legs and feet often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Lobito?
Being prepared before your flight will make your trip to Lobito easy and painless. We've rounded up some handy tips for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Airport security personnel first need to establish that you have a valid ID and matching boarding pass before you can proceed any further. Keep them within easy reach.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ything on you that is likely to beep.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• Electronic devices like phones and laptops will also have to go through the machine for inspection. Don't wor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Can't travel without your favourite cologne? As long as the volume is no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-lock bag, you're perm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on luggage.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several minutes. Boots and heavy sh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on sneakers are usually not.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them safely away in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ed on board.
